The takeaway here is, medical terminology is often pejorative towards the medicalized. Autism is not exceptional in this regard.
If you removed all stigma from autism, and only autism... a lot of autistic people would still experience ableist stigma, because we're multiply disabled. And we'd know how little the autistic people who'd now claim they're not disabled would think of us.
(This is not exclusive to autism. I'm generally opposed to disability exceptionalism—it does not help us as a coalition if certain people argue for respect on the basis of "but I'm not actually disabled" if that leaves everyone else up a creek!)
